We were previously led to believe that the Solo: A Star Wars Story trailer would drop last week, but now a far more reliable source is reporting that we will get our first look at Alden Ehrenreich in action as the iconic space-smuggler this Sunday.

According to THR, the marketing campaign for the standalone Star Wars flick is set to kick-off with a Super Bowl spot that'll air during the New England Patriots Vs. Philadelphia Eagles game - though they do caution that Disney has not officially confirmed this.

We are now less than four months away from Solo: A Star Wars Story's theatrical release, and a lot of fans are concerned that we still haven't seen so much as an official image or poster yet. If this teaser does hit on Sunday, let's hope it's strong enough to get the numerous naysayers on board the Falcon.
